pmcl πŸ‡¨πŸ‡¦ | 7 ratings
Posted over 5 years ago

it’s all about managing your expectations. At this price point (approx $35 Canadian) it’s rare to find a Rum that one can sip without grimacing. It competes with the Planation Grand Reserve 5 yr old for a value priced sipping rum and may actually come out ahead although there’s more than a $5 price difference between the two. It’s not as smooth as the higher priced sippers but you can’t expect it to be at this price. What it lacks in refinement is more than compensated for by its complexity and pleasant taste.
